Solution
1. Preparation
  • Gather necessary tools: None required for this process.
  • Ensure the vehicle is in a safe, stationary position with the ignition off.
2. Resetting the Service Light
  1. Turn Ignition On: Insert the key and turn it to the "On" position, ensuring that all dashboard lights illuminate without starting the engine.
  2. Press and Hold Trip Odometer Reset: Locate the trip odometer reset button on the instrument cluster and press it down. Keep it pressed throughout the next steps.
  3. Turn Ignition Off: While continuing to hold the trip odometer reset button, turn the ignition off completely.
  4. Turn Ignition On Again: Turn the ignition back to the "On" position without starting the engine, still holding the trip odometer reset button.
  5. Release the Button: After a few seconds, the service light should blink and then turn off. Release the trip odometer reset button.
